A late 18th century Dutch Delft pottery polychrome dish. The interior of the dish is decorated with a hand painted scene of a vase with brightly coloured flowers and birds. The edge of the dish has a painted lattice and oval decoration. The dish is in good condition apart from the usual nicks around the rim that are common on Delft Ware dishes. (Circa 1790) Diameter 35.5cm (14 inches) Depth 5.5cm (2 inches)
